Research Abstract

1 The localization of thrombospondin (TSP) in hepatocellular carcinoma (HCC) was investigated by light and electron microscopic immunohistochemical studies. Tissue specimens were obtained by surgical resection from sixty patients with HCC.In light microscopic immunohistochemistry, all specimens showed strong TSP expression in fibrous tissues in HCC and surrounding non-malignant areas. In 31 of 60 cases, TSP expression was observed in HCC cells. In electron microscopic immunohistochemistry, TSP was localized in the rough endoplasmic reticulum (RER) of HCC cells, and also in the RER of fibroblasts and endothelial cells. These findings proved that TSP was synthesized in HCC cells, in endothelial cells, in fibroblasts surrounding the tumor, and further suggested that TSP in the fibrous tissues surrounding carcinoma was basically synthesized by nonparenchymal cells such as fibroblasts and endothelial cells.
2 To explore the role of TSP of HCC we measured blood TSP levels by indirect ELISA fr … More om 30 control subjects and 30 patients with HCC.In HCC patients, elevated levels of TSP greater than the mean value for controls ranging were found. Moreover, in intrahepatic metastasis of HCC,TSP levels were greater than nonmetastasis. These results suggested that TSP may play a role in metastasis of HCC and could serve as a blood marker for metastasis.
3. In light microscopic and electron microscopic immunohistochemistry, HCC cells showed TSP and its receptor expression. Addition of anti-TSP antibody to cultured medium showed marked suppression of cell proliferation in HCC cells. On the other hand, addition of TSP to culture medium stimulated cell proliferation, in KYN-2 and KYN-3. Furthermore, the effect of anti-TSP antibody induced growth arrest in the G_0G_1 phase of the cell cycle and decreased DNA synthesis on HuH-7 cell. Addition of anti-CSVTCG receptor antibody to cultured medium showed marked suppression of cell proliferation. In conclusion, TSP promoted the proliferation of HCC cells. Less
